The registry NCC-1701 has been held by the first USS Enterprise under the command of Captain Christopher Pike and then Captain James Tiberius Kirk. It was then retained when the ship was refitted to coincide with the start of the first motion picture called, erm, The Motion Picture. When the original Enterprise was destroyed under by Kirk in ST III: Search for Spock, Starfleet renamed, and re-registered, the USS Yorktown NCC-1717 to bear the moniker USS Enterprise with the registration NCC-1701-A.

Subsequent registrations and comanders are as follows:

NCC-1701-B : Captain John Harriman. Seen at start of Star Trek : Generations.
NCC-1701-C : Captain Rachel Garrett. Seen in ST:TNG episode 'Yesterdays Enterprise' with Shooter McGavin as her Number One. Arf.
NCC-1701-D : Captain Jean-Luc Picard. Destroyed by Nexus/The petulent boy Riker in Star Trek : Generations
NCC-1701-E : Captain Jean-Luc Picard. Still going...
